VGP invest in Magic with Cold Foil Technology

Turnhout, March 21, 2022 I Van Genechten Packaging (VGP) are proud to announce the successful commissioning of a brand-new offset printing capability utilising cold foil technology at their site in Angoulême, France. Installed and commissioned in partnership with Vinfoil, the machine will be producing its first orders in April, with more projects already in the pipeline.

 Why Coldfoil?

Cold foil technology allows VGP to stay on the cutting edge of consumer packaging and is a perfect fit for the company’s ambitions to be seen as best-in-class in the markets they operate in. It offers a cost effective, easily optimised and efficient solution to premium-packaging customers, but also provides substantial sustainability benefits.

Smart use of material and built-in recyclability help reduce the technology’s environmental impact significantly. Meanwhile, the process itself represents a reduction in foil waste.

Investing in Magic

The new machine is set to be a boost to everybody on the team at Angoulême, allowing them to improve their speed to market by bringing a process in-house that was previously provided externally. VGP pride themselves on their “one-stop” approach and cold foil enhances their capabilities here.

The business case behind investing in the new process was, like everything at VGP, focused on the needs of their customers and improving their already impressive sustainability credentials. The cold foil press offers customers brilliant, metallic accent colours, whilst reducing their environmental impact: a win-win.

Jérôme Cahu, Plant Manager VG Angoulême, told us:

My team and I are very proud to have this extra capability up and running so fast. VGP’s investment is starting to pay off with the machine’s early output already well booked and the additional capacity opening up the potential for new customers to enjoy the company’s innovative approach. This innovative process fits perfectly alongside our offerings of hotfoil, metallization transfer and metallic inks, meaning we have the perfect solution for any market need.”

About Angoulême

VGP’s Angoulême site is specialised in the production of packaging for high-end products, such as premium spirits, and customised finishing techniques.

The demand for sustainable packaging in the premium products industry has been growing exponentially over the last 5 years. VGP has made a number of substantial investments towards increasing sustainability to cater to this demand and VG Angoulême is especially focused on creative and sustainable premium packaging. The reward for these efforts was when the plant earned CO2 Compensation Certification for the first time in 2020, a recognition that was recently renewed.
